drm/msm: Add an ftrace for gpu register access

With IFPC, there is a probability of accessing a GX domain register when
it is collapsed, which leads to gmu fence errors. To debug this, we need
to trace every gpu register accesses and identify the one just before a
gmu fence error. So, add an ftrace to track all gpu register accesses.
